Jay Blades MBE, presenter of the BBC’s beloved The Repair Shop, returns to the podcast for a second time with his infectious energy and soulful wisdom — this time, sharing his belief in the power of using human connection to strengthen communities through craft. 

WHY YOU WILL ENJOY THIS EPISODE
  • You’ll hear how Jay leans into vulnerability, seeing it as being an essential tool for transformation 
  • Be inspired by his dedication to bringing people together through creativity and craft, to make a difference in the world
  • Learn more about the power of embracing change and using it as a catalyst for growth
